Liver transplantation in propionic acidaemia.
J. M. Saudubray,Guy Touati,Pascale Delonlay,Philippe Jouvet,J. S. Schlenzig,C. Narcy,J. Laurent,Daniel Rabier,Pierre Kamoun,Dominique Jan,Yann Revillon +10 more
TL;DR: It is considered that at the moment OLT should only be performed in severe forms of PA, mostly characterised by frequent and unexpected episodes of metabolic decompensation despite good dietary therapy, and a more generalised indication for OLT in PA will require more information about the long-term outcome of transplanted patients.

Arginine remains an essential amino acid after liver transplantation in urea cycle enzyme deficiencies.
TL;DR: The experience of two patients whose livers were replaced because of OTC deficiency and argininosuccinate synthetase (ASS) deficiency is reported, suggesting the importance of the extrahepatic parts of the urea cycle.
